RVTY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2017 in Review
350 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Revvity (RVTY) for Q3 2017, worth a combined $7.02B — up 1.4% from $6.92B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 47 funds opened new RVTY positions and 33 closed out — a net gain of 14 holders — while 121 added to existing stakes and 111 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Select Equity Group, adding an estimated $151M. The largest seller was Fidelity International, cutting an estimated $131M.
